How Our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Process Works

When you call our team for sump pump overflow water removal, we’ll send a certified technician to your property within 60 minutes. Our technician will assess the situation, identify the source of the overflow, and develop a customized plan to restore your home. We use top-of-the-line equ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and high-velocity drying systems, to ensure efficient and effective water removal.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technician will evaluate the extent of the damage, identify the source of the overflow, and create a customized plan to restore your home.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use truck-mounted extractors to remove standing water from your home’s floors and surfaces.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our technician will use high-velocity drying systems to dry your home’s surfaces and remove excess moisture. This step typ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the water has been removed and your home is dry, our technician will cl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

Our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ition. This may involve minor repairs or replacement of damaged materials.

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Cost in Lakeland North, WA

The cost of sump pump overflow water removal in Lakeland North,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500, with most jobs falling in the $1,000 to $1,500 range. The final cost will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Final inspection and restoration $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Emergency response and assessment $200 – $500 Time of day, severity of damage, and local conditions
Equipment rental and usage $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
